/**
 * acpi_idle_enter_bm - enters C3 with proper BM handling
 * @dev: the target CPU
 * @state: the state data
 *
 * If BM is detected, the deepest non-C3 idle state is entered instead.
 */
static int acpi_idle_enter_bm(struct cpuidle_device *dev,
			      struct cpuidle_state *state)
{
	struct acpi_processor *pr;
	struct acpi_processor_cx *cx = cpuidle_get_statedata(state);
	ktime_t  kt1, kt2;
	s64 idle_time_ns;
	s64 idle_time;


	pr = __get_cpu_var(processors);

	if (unlikely(!pr))
		return 0;

	if (acpi_idle_suspend)
		return(acpi_idle_enter_c1(dev, state));

	if (!cx->bm_sts_skip && acpi_idle_bm_check()) {
		if (dev->safe_state) {
			dev->last_state = dev->safe_state;
			return dev->safe_state->enter(dev, dev->safe_state);
		} else {
			local_irq_disable();
			acpi_safe_halt();
			local_irq_enable();
			return 0;
		}
	}

	local_irq_disable();

	if (cx->entry_method != ACPI_CSTATE_FFH) {
		current_thread_info()->status &= ~TS_POLLING;
		/*
		 * TS_POLLING-cleared state must be visible before we test
		 * NEED_RESCHED:
		 */
		smp_mb();

		if (unlikely(need_resched())) {
			current_thread_info()->status |= TS_POLLING;
			local_irq_enable();
			return 0;
		}
	}

	acpi_unlazy_tlb(smp_processor_id());

	/* Tell the scheduler that we are going deep-idle: */
	sched_clock_idle_sleep_event();
	/*
	 * Must be done before busmaster disable as we might need to
	 * access HPET !
	 */
	lapic_timer_state_broadcast(pr, cx, 1);

	kt1 = ktime_get_real();
	/*
	 * disable bus master
	 * bm_check implies we need ARB_DIS
	 * !bm_check implies we need cache flush
	 * bm_control implies whether we can do ARB_DIS
	 *
	 * That leaves a case where bm_check is set and bm_control is
	 * not set. In that case we cannot do much, we enter C3
	 * without doing anything.
	 */
	if (pr->flags.bm_check && pr->flags.bm_control) {
		spin_lock(&c3_lock);
		c3_cpu_count++;
		/* Disable bus master arbitration when all CPUs are in C3 */
		if (c3_cpu_count == num_online_cpus())
			acpi_write_bit_register(ACPI_BITREG_ARB_DISABLE, 1);
		spin_unlock(&c3_lock);
	} else if (!pr->flags.bm_check) {
		ACPI_FLUSH_CPU_CACHE();
	}

	acpi_idle_do_entry(cx);

	/* Re-enable bus master arbitration */
	if (pr->flags.bm_check && pr->flags.bm_control) {
		spin_lock(&c3_lock);
		acpi_write_bit_register(ACPI_BITREG_ARB_DISABLE, 0);
		c3_cpu_count--;
		spin_unlock(&c3_lock);
	}
	kt2 = ktime_get_real();
	idle_time_ns = ktime_to_ns(ktime_sub(kt2, kt1));
	idle_time = idle_time_ns;
	do_div(idle_time, NSEC_PER_USEC);

	/* Tell the scheduler how much we idled: */
	sched_clock_idle_wakeup_event(idle_time_ns);

	local_irq_enable();
	if (cx->entry_method != ACPI_CSTATE_FFH)
		current_thread_info()->status |= TS_POLLING;

	cx->usage++;

	lapic_timer_state_broadcast(pr, cx, 0);
	cx->time += idle_time;
	return idle_time;
}

/**
 * acpi_idle_enter_simple - enters an ACPI state without BM handling
 * @dev: the target CPU
 * @state: the state data
 */
static int acpi_idle_enter_simple(struct cpuidle_device *dev,
				  struct cpuidle_state *state)
{
	struct acpi_processor *pr;
	struct acpi_processor_cx *cx = cpuidle_get_statedata(state);
	ktime_t  kt1, kt2;
	s64 idle_time_ns;
	s64 idle_time;

	pr = __get_cpu_var(processors);

	if (unlikely(!pr))
		return 0;

	if (acpi_idle_suspend)
		return(acpi_idle_enter_c1(dev, state));

	local_irq_disable();

	if (cx->entry_method != ACPI_CSTATE_FFH) {
		current_thread_info()->status &= ~TS_POLLING;
		/*
		 * TS_POLLING-cleared state must be visible before we test
		 * NEED_RESCHED:
		 */
		smp_mb();

		if (unlikely(need_resched())) {
			current_thread_info()->status |= TS_POLLING;
			local_irq_enable();
			return 0;
		}
	}

	/*
	 * Must be done before busmaster disable as we might need to
	 * access HPET !
	 */
	lapic_timer_state_broadcast(pr, cx, 1);

	if (cx->type == ACPI_STATE_C3)
		ACPI_FLUSH_CPU_CACHE();

	kt1 = ktime_get_real();
	/* Tell the scheduler that we are going deep-idle: */
	sched_clock_idle_sleep_event();
	acpi_idle_do_entry(cx);
	kt2 = ktime_get_real();
	idle_time_ns = ktime_to_ns(ktime_sub(kt2, kt1));
	idle_time = idle_time_ns;
	do_div(idle_time, NSEC_PER_USEC);

	/* Tell the scheduler how much we idled: */
	sched_clock_idle_wakeup_event(idle_time_ns);

	local_irq_enable();
	if (cx->entry_method != ACPI_CSTATE_FFH)
		current_thread_info()->status |= TS_POLLING;

	cx->usage++;

	lapic_timer_state_broadcast(pr, cx, 0);
	cx->time += idle_time;
	return idle_time;
}
